苹果失误泄露内部Claude.md文件,官方App意外暴露AI客服架构
2026/05/02 14:52阅读量 27
苹果Apple Support应用v5.13更新意外携带了Claude.md文件,证实苹果内部使用Claude Code进行生产级开发。文件暴露了客服系统的双后端(AI自动应答和真人客服无缝切换)及三角色消息设计。该事件引发了对AI生成代码审查机制的讨论,也显示苹果在内部开发上已深度依赖Anthropic的Claude模型。
事件概述
苹果官方售后服务应用Apple Support在2026年5月1日推送的v5.13版本中,意外将Claude.md文件打包进发布版。该文件被MacRumors分析师Aaron Perris发现并曝光,证实苹果内部确实使用Claude Code(Anthropic的AI编码工具)来构建生产级应用。苹果在24小时内紧急撤回该版本,但相关内容已被解析。
核心信息
- 泄露文件内容:Claude.md文件描述了Apple Support的聊天系统架构。核心设计为一套双后端系统:Juno AI负责自动应答,Live Agents负责真人客服接管,两者通过一个Protocol协议层无缝切换。消息系统采用三角色设计(client/agent/assistant),用户无法区分回复来自AI还是人类客服。
- 其他暴露文件:另一份泄露的SAComponents模块为纯UI组件库,无业务逻辑,但证实了苹果工程化产物的规范性。
- 苹果与Anthropic的关系:此前彭博社Mark Gurman已指出,苹果在自家服务器上运行定制版Claude模型,内部代码和文档不离开苹果基础设施。本次事件进一步佐证苹果内部开发已深度依赖Claude而非Gemini。不过有前苹果员工表示,苹果有数百个隔离团队,部分团队使用Claude不代表全公司都在用AI编码。
值得关注
- 审查流程缺失:Claude.md本不应进入发布包,问题在于AI生成的代码缺乏有效审查。开发者对Claude.md是否应纳入版本控制存在争议,但更根本的漏洞是发布流程未能拦截该文件。有评论指出,苹果对Claude过于信任,而代码审查本应防止这类失误。
- 行业现象:一项针对12万开发者的调查显示,92.6%的开发者每月至少使用一次AI编码助手。苹果的失误只是行业缩影,AI时代如何确保代码质量和安全性成为普遍挑战。
